L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WDRB) -- A Coxs Creek man is dead after a crash involving three vehicles in Bullitt County Wednesday night.Â
It happened in the 800 block of S. Bardstown Road (US 31E), just south of Mt. Washington around 8 p.m. according to a news release from Kentucky State Police.Â
That's when Kentucky State Police Post 4 received a call from Bullitt County 911 Dispatch requesting assistance. According to the preliminary investigation, a Jeep Grand Cherokee was southbound on US 31E when it "crossed the center line and struck a Chevrolet Cavalier that was traveling northbound head-on."
A Ford F-250, that also traveling northbound, then crashed into the Chevrolet. The driver of the Chevrolet -- 26-year-old Gary Bowman of Coxs Creek -- was pronounced dead at the scene by the Bullitt County Coroner's Office.
The driver of the Jeep was taken to UofL Hospital with life-threatening injuries. The driver and a passenger of the Ford pickup truck were not injured.
The affected portion of US 31E was closed down for several hours while troopers reconstructed the collision.Â
